1 | >> Pango is enabled by default in Firefox 1.5. |
2 | >> export MOZ_DISABLE_PANGO=1 and try again. |
3 | |
4 | > Wow. Thanks a lot, I missed that post in the forums. |
5 | > It seems to make a difference. |
6 | > Why does Pango support cripple the thing? |
7 | |
8 | AFAIK it's supposed to be capable of rendering some complex Asian |
9 | scripts. Unfortunately it comes with a huge performance hit. |
10 | Why? I don't know:( |
